In addition to San Antonio, Estella also lived in Clarkston. Phone number listed for Estella is (718) 625-0499. Her birth year was listed as 1942. Estella has reached 83 years of age. People possibly related to Estella are Ruth Lynne Webb, Elizabeth Carla Webb, Joseph Nathan Webb and 4 other people. Estella now resides at 21 Andover Creek Dr, San Antonio, Tx 78254.